Question 1055911:  Two dice both four sided and fair are rolled simultaneously and the product of the two numbers showing up is recorded
 
Tabulate :A) the possible outcomes 
          B) the sample space
 
C) Calculate the probability that the product will be : 
1) an even number 
2) an odd number 
3) 18
 
D) Draw a venn diagram to illustrate the sample space(S) of this experiment and events E-even product and O-odd product
 
E) Why are events E and O mutually exclusive?

You can  put this solution on YOUR website! The sample space is {all possible outcomes}=(11,12,13,14,21,22,23,24,31,32,33,34,41,42,43,44} 
The product will be even 3/4 the time, 12,14,21,22,23,24,32,34,41,42,43,44. 
It will be odd 1/4 the time, 11,13,31,33 
It will never be 18--null set. 
Even and odd are mutually exclusive, because a number can not be both odd and even at the same time.
